About the Stronger Homes Grant
The Stronger Homes Grant is jointly funded by the Australian and Queensland governments through the Commonwealth-State Disaster Recovery Funding Arrangements.
If your home was damaged during the January and February 2025 North and Far North Queensland floods, you could get funding to help improve your home’s resilience against future flooding.
Grants of up to $10,000 are available to cover eligible works on your home.

Why should I apply?
The Stronger Homes Grant will help make your home more resilient, reducing the effort, cost, time and trauma of clean-up and recovery following a flood.
With this grant, you can do things like raise electrical switchboards, air conditioning units and hot water systems, or install flood-resilient floor coverings and wall linings.
This means if your home is flooded again, you’ll be able to recover quicker.
